Low Volume Production

Low-volume manufacturing produces small quantities (typically 1 to 1,000 parts) at production-representative quality. It is suitable for pre-production validation, market testing, replacement parts, and programs where annual volumes do not justify full tooling investment.

CNC machining, vacuum casting, and soft-tooling injection molding are the primary methods used at this volume tier.

Our Low-Volume Capabilities

CNC Machining

Direct from CAD: no tooling required. Produces metal and plastic parts with tight tolerances and production-grade material properties. Suitable for 1-500 units where machining is economically competitive.

Vacuum Casting

Silicone mold casting for 5-25 parts per mold. Production-like surface quality in PU resins. Suitable for appearance and functional validation parts requiring injection-molded aesthetics.

Soft-Tooling Injection Molding

Aluminium molds for 50-1,000 injection-molded plastic parts. Lower tooling cost than production steel. Produces true injection-molded parts for functional testing and early market supply.

3D Printing

For 1-10 parts where speed takes priority. SLA for high-resolution cosmetic parts; SLS for functional nylon parts. Bridges the gap between design iteration and first physical part.
